make -C tools/testing/selftests TARGETS="net" TEST_PROGS=udpgso_bench.sh TTEST_GEN_PROGS="" run_tests make: Entering directory '/home/virtme/testing-1/tools/testing/selftests' make[1]: Entering directory '/home/virtme/testing-1/tools/testing/selftests/net' make[1]: Nothing to be done for 'all'. make[1]: Leaving directory '/home/virtme/testing-1/tools/testing/selftests/net' make[1]: Entering directory '/home/virtme/testing-1/tools/testing/selftests/net' TAP version 13 1..1 # timeout set to 3600 # selftests: net: udpgso_bench.sh # ipv4 # tcp # tcp tx: 11259 MB/s 190973 calls/s 190973 msg/s # tcp rx: 11264 MB/s 187853 calls/s # tcp tx: 10562 MB/s 179151 calls/s 179151 msg/s # tcp rx: 10580 MB/s 172788 calls/s # tcp tx: 11767 MB/s 199580 calls/s 199580 msg/s # tcp zerocopy # tcp tx: 6066 MB/s 102896 calls/s 102896 msg/s # tcp rx: 6071 MB/s 102256 calls/s # tcp tx: 6195 MB/s 105082 calls/s 105082 msg/s # tcp rx: 6209 MB/s 105164 calls/s # tcp tx: 6182 MB/s 104851 calls/s 104851 msg/s # udp # udp rx: 982 MB/s 699692 calls/s # udp tx: 1050 MB/s 748020 calls/s 17810 msg/s # udp rx: 1177 MB/s 839026 calls/s # udp tx: 1173 MB/s 835800 calls/s 19900 msg/s # udp rx: 1100 MB/s 784210 calls/s # udp tx: 1100 MB/s 784140 calls/s 18670 msg/s # udp gso # udp rx: 3453 MB/s 2460305 calls/s # udp tx: 4223 MB/s 71631 calls/s 71631 msg/s # udp rx: 2576 MB/s 1835014 calls/s # udp tx: 2872 MB/s 48716 calls/s 48716 msg/s # udp rx: 2244 MB/s 1598865 calls/s # udp tx: 2272 MB/s 38535 calls/s 38535 msg/s # udp gso zerocopy # udp rx: 2037 MB/s 1451699 calls/s # udp tx: 2472 MB/s 41942 calls/s 41942 msg/s # udp rx: 1866 MB/s 1329628 calls/s # udp tx: 1857 MB/s 31496 calls/s 31496 msg/s # udp rx: 1790 MB/s 1275357 calls/s # udp tx: 1825 MB/s 30968 calls/s 30968 msg/s # udp gso timestamp # udp rx: 1982 MB/s 1412386 calls/s # udp tx: 2773 MB/s 47034 calls/s 47034 msg/s # udp rx: 2210 MB/s 1574400 calls/s # udp tx: 2715 MB/s 46058 calls/s 46058 msg/s # udp rx: 2201 MB/s 1568000 calls/s # udp tx: 2736 MB/s 46405 calls/s 46405 msg/s # udp gso zerocopy audit # udp rx: 1814 MB/s 1292604 calls/s # udp tx: 2150 MB/s 36467 calls/s 36467 msg/s # udp rx: 1959 MB/s 1396111 calls/s # udp tx: 2084 MB/s 35362 calls/s 35362 msg/s # udp rx: 1946 MB/s 1386416 calls/s # udp tx: 2071 MB/s 35132 calls/s 35132 msg/s # Summary over 3.000 seconds... # sum udp tx: 2152 MB/s 106961 calls (35653/s) 106961 msgs (35653/s) # Zerocopy acks: 106961 # udp gso timestamp audit # udp rx: 1880 MB/s 1339812 calls/s # udp tx: 2660 MB/s 45130 calls/s 45130 msg/s # udp rx: 2060 MB/s 1467489 calls/s # udp tx: 2634 MB/s 44678 calls/s 44678 msg/s # udp rx: 2059 MB/s 1467360 calls/s # udp tx: 2794 MB/s 47395 calls/s 47395 msg/s # Summary over 3.000 seconds... # sum udp tx: 2761 MB/s 137203 calls (45734/s) 137203 msgs (45734/s) # Tx Timestamps: 137203 received 0 errors # udp gso zerocopy timestamp audit # udp rx: 1587 MB/s 1130967 calls/s # udp tx: 1740 MB/s 29514 calls/s 29514 msg/s # udp rx: 1802 MB/s 1284051 calls/s # udp tx: 1868 MB/s 31698 calls/s 31698 msg/s # udp rx: 1769 MB/s 1260381 calls/s # udp tx: 1849 MB/s 31376 calls/s 31376 msg/s # Summary over 3.000 seconds... # sum udp tx: 1863 MB/s 92588 calls (30862/s) 92588 msgs (30862/s) # Tx Timestamps: 92588 received 0 errors # Zerocopy acks: 92588 # ipv6 # tcp # tcp tx: 7658 MB/s 129886 calls/s 129886 msg/s # tcp rx: 7659 MB/s 105976 calls/s # tcp tx: 7986 MB/s 135457 calls/s 135457 msg/s # tcp rx: 7994 MB/s 104044 calls/s # tcp tx: 8246 MB/s 139860 calls/s 139860 msg/s # tcp zerocopy # tcp tx: 4506 MB/s 76431 calls/s 76431 msg/s # tcp rx: 4513 MB/s 73690 calls/s # tcp tx: 5869 MB/s 99545 calls/s 99545 msg/s # tcp rx: 5881 MB/s 99508 calls/s # tcp tx: 5935 MB/s 100664 calls/s 100664 msg/s # udp # udp rx: 997 MB/s 727241 calls/s # udp tx: 1058 MB/s 771936 calls/s 17952 msg/s # udp rx: 1053 MB/s 768633 calls/s # udp tx: 1053 MB/s 768582 calls/s 17874 msg/s # udp rx: 1058 MB/s 771985 calls/s # udp tx: 1057 MB/s 771549 calls/s 17943 msg/s # udp gso # udp rx: 2226 MB/s 1623575 calls/s # udp tx: 2355 MB/s 39959 calls/s 39959 msg/s # udp rx: 2325 MB/s 1695895 calls/s # udp tx: 2471 MB/s 41924 calls/s 41924 msg/s # udp rx: 2283 MB/s 1665390 calls/s # udp tx: 2285 MB/s 38759 calls/s 38759 msg/s # udp gso zerocopy # udp rx: 2609 MB/s 1902784 calls/s # udp tx: 2901 MB/s 49217 calls/s 49217 msg/s # udp rx: 2922 MB/s 2131234 calls/s # udp tx: 2969 MB/s 50366 calls/s 50366 msg/s # udp rx: 3063 MB/s 2234001 calls/s # udp tx: 3032 MB/s 51435 calls/s 51435 msg/s # udp gso timestamp # udp rx: 3548 MB/s 2586223 calls/s # udp tx: 4168 MB/s 70699 calls/s 70699 msg/s # udp rx: 3833 MB/s 2794290 calls/s # udp tx: 4138 MB/s 70185 calls/s 70185 msg/s # udp rx: 3843 MB/s 2801468 calls/s # udp tx: 4117 MB/s 69836 calls/s 69836 msg/s # udp gso zerocopy audit # udp rx: 2809 MB/s 2048568 calls/s # udp tx: 3182 MB/s 53972 calls/s 53972 msg/s # udp rx: 3075 MB/s 2242870 calls/s # udp tx: 3326 MB/s 56416 calls/s 56416 msg/s # udp rx: 3035 MB/s 2213505 calls/s # udp tx: 3386 MB/s 57442 calls/s 57442 msg/s # Summary over 3.000 seconds... # sum udp tx: 3377 MB/s 167830 calls (55943/s) 167830 msgs (55943/s) # Zerocopy acks: 167830 # udp gso timestamp audit # udp rx: 3130 MB/s 2281640 calls/s # udp tx: 3937 MB/s 66789 calls/s 66789 msg/s # udp rx: 3735 MB/s 2722476 calls/s # udp tx: 4222 MB/s 71619 calls/s 71619 msg/s # udp rx: 3749 MB/s 2732691 calls/s # udp tx: 4208 MB/s 71384 calls/s 71384 msg/s # Summary over 3.000 seconds... # sum udp tx: 4222 MB/s 209792 calls (69930/s) 209792 msgs (69930/s) # Tx Timestamps: 209792 received 0 errors # udp gso zerocopy timestamp audit # udp rx: 2563 MB/s 1869797 calls/s # udp tx: 2761 MB/s 46829 calls/s 46829 msg/s # udp rx: 2806 MB/s 2046646 calls/s # udp tx: 2845 MB/s 48257 calls/s 48257 msg/s # udp rx: 2847 MB/s 2076597 calls/s # udp tx: 2876 MB/s 48782 calls/s 48782 msg/s # Summary over 3.000 seconds... # sum udp tx: 2895 MB/s 143868 calls (47956/s) 143868 msgs (47956/s) # Tx Timestamps: 143868 received 0 errors # Zerocopy acks: 143868 # udpgso_bench.sh: PASS=18 SKIP=0 FAIL=0 # udpgso_bench.sh: [0;92mPASS[0m ok 1 selftests: net: udpgso_bench.sh make[1]: Leaving directory '/home/virtme/testing-1/tools/testing/selftests/net' make: Leaving directory '/home/virtme/testing-1/tools/testing/selftests' xx__-> echo $? 0 xx__->